Did 50 Cent perform at the Super Bowl 2022? The 2022 Pepsi Super Bowl Halftime Show included a very special guest in its first half: 50 Cent, who followed Snoop Dogg and Dr. Dre with a surprise performance of his Dre-co-produced smash “In Da Club.”

Did Dr. Dre pay for halftime show?

Dre, Snoop Dogg, Eminem, Mary J. Blige, and Kendrick Lamar won’t be paid to perform the #SuperBowl halftime show. In fact, Dr. Dre has put up most of the $7 million budget himself and bought a box at SoFi Stadium for friends to watch, per @eriqgardner.

WHO adopted Lift Every Voice and Sing?

As part of a celebration of Abraham Lincoln’s birthday on February 12, 1900, “Lift Every Voice and Sing” was first publicly performed by 500 school children at the Stanton School in Jacksonville, Florida. The school principal, James Weldon Johnson, wrote the words and Johnson’s brother Rosamond set them to music.

What commercial was so kiss a little longer hold hands a little longer?

Seeing a need in the cinnamon gum market for a full-sizes stick, Wrigley launched the campaign in 1979. The advertising campaign’s jingle and refrain, “Kiss a Little Longer” became familiar to viewers across the United States in the years afterwards when it was used.

What is the most annoying commercial jingle? The repetitive jingle for Liberty Mutual tops both the most hated and the most annoying lists — but it also lands in the top 10 for catchiest. The jingle for Sara Lee is by far the most commonly misheard, with 74.6% of people thinking the lyrics are, “Nobody does it like Sara Lee.”
